By integrating V2G technology with wind power, excess energy generated during high wind periods can be stored in EV batteries. When the wind slows and power generation dips, the stored energy can be fed back into the grid, smoothing out supply variations..

Solar and wind together account for almost 60 percent of the world’s 3.3 terawatts of non-fossil-based electricity generating capacity, which translates to approximately 25 percent of total global generating capacity of 7.9 terawatts. At that ratio, the world’s generating capacity that is. .

But adding solar panels and large-scale energy storage batteries throws a curveball into the traditional relationship between utility companies and their customers. Now those customers are in a position to send some electricity back to the grid when asked and to avoid drawing power from the grid.
